    I just adopted Daisy from PAWS Chicago and quickly learned she was a picky princess. Knowing she had to grow quickly as she had a litter of puppies at only 11 months old, I was happy to spoil her. The kibble the shelter provided remained untouched for three meals in a row, and mixing in wet food meant she was picking out just the wet food. I also tried to start training her with treats I got at PetCo but she ignored the treats, and I began to think she wasn't food motivated. Since I'm a new pet owner, I was hoping there was a pet shop close to home in Andersonville and I came across Jameson Loves Danger. I came in and the guy at the counter helped me navigate the dog food options after I explained Daisy does not like dry food. I found some dry food toppers Daisy absolutely loves (Stella and Chewys meal mixers and Stella's Stew). Daisy at her whole bowl including the kibble! She didn't like the bacon flavored treat but was glad to hear of their 100% guarantee which meant I could exchange the treat for something else. We tried a few samples and the recommended freeze dried chicken (VitalEssentials) was a home run. Daisy is definitely food motivated now! I went ahead and booked a grooming appointment but recommend making them in advance since the earliest available was 3 weeks out. She also looks really cute in her new collar. I know she is getting a new toy from her next time since she wants already going crazy at some of the toys just walking by them in the store. I will definitely be back to spoil this perfect baby! Such a neighborhood gem.

    When we first adopted Meowth and Persian, "Felines and Canines," the animal shelter near Devon and Clark, referred us to "Jameson Loves Danger" with a 10% off coupon. We bought a bag of cat litter and a litter tray soon after the adoption paperwork was completed. Our first impression of this local pet store was very positive. The workers there were very helpful, seemed to like what they do, and invited us to come back. Andersonville is one of the neighborhoods in the city hubby and I constantly poke around on our days off. Since we needed a few thing for our feline sons, we made a trip to JLD on the way back home. Prices for cat essentials, such as cat litter, dry food, can treats, and toys were reasonable. I could see there were different "grades" of cat foods, and prices could vary by up to $5. Well, we consumers would make decisions based on our budgets and needs. Even though JLD is a relatively small shop, selections on this category were impressive. My "Meowth" loved the b.f.f. (best feline friend) can treat. He went a bit bonkers. They signed us up with the loyalty program. It certainly didn't hurt to be rewarded for the items we had to purchase on a regular basis.

    Does this business sell Tea Cup yorkie puppies?

    Hi Nanette! We do not carry any animals available for adoption. It isn't legal in the state of Illinois to commercially sell dogs and cats. I would recommend reaching out to a breeder or checking out the many adoptable animals at local shelters!
